Importance of CL Across Different Sectors
Continuous Learning (CL) in education has gained traction as more people recognise the importance of lifelong learning. According to a recent report by the World Economic Forum, 94% of business leaders say they expect their employees to pick up new skills on the job. Emphasising CL fosters a culture of growth and adaptation, allowing organisations to stay competitive.
In the realm of technology, CL often refers to Command Line interfaces. The rise of programming and development skills have made understanding CL crucial for developers. As per a survey by Stack Overflow, approximately 75% of developers reported using command-line tools regularly, highlighting its significance in software development.
Recent Developments in CL
Recently, the concept of CL has been bolstered by advancements in machine learning and artificial intelligence. For instance, the integration of algorithms that facilitate continuous learning is reshaping how data is analysed and processed. These changes allow systems to improve their outputs over time, increasing accuracy and efficiency.
Furthermore, in the context of education, platforms such as Coursera and Udemy have introduced new features to enhance continuous learning by offering personalized recommendations based on user progress and interests. This evolution in e-learning showcases the growing importance of CL as a driving force in academic and professional development.
